Transaction ecf77e8794e1f3dac6fb8fa529ebbf86ff8574a7281af57ebd5b002d857a3767

1 Input
2 Outputs
  • ecf77e8794e1f3dac6fb8fa529ebbf86ff8574a7281af57ebd5b002d857a3767:0
  • value  43181973
    address  373f2G8ENw8W9ASmXg4MyaDjmznNxeNNdu
  • ecf77e8794e1f3dac6fb8fa529ebbf86ff8574a7281af57ebd5b002d857a3767:1
  • value  553353
    address  1ADtvtBVgGi2G39D2eBnRWrNSJChZr6MXB